THE BEST LENTIL SALAD, EVER



The Best Lentil Salad, Ever image

This recipe was created by Sarah Britton and posted on the My New Roots blog. She calls it the best lentil salad ever, and I have to agree. I serve this over a small bed of baby arugula, and top the salad with some crumbled goat cheese for a healthy, tasty meatless meal. Other optional add-ins mentioned by Sarah are walnuts, fresh herbs & sprouts.

8 ounces dry lentils
3 tablespoons olive oil
2 tablespoons apple cider vinegar
1/2 tablespoon maple syrup
1/2 tablespoon stone ground mustard
1 te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on pepper
1/2 teaspoon ground cumin
1/4 teaspoon turmeric
1/4 teaspoon ground coriander
1/4 teaspoon ground cardamom
1/8 teaspoon cayenne pepper
1/8 teaspoon ground cloves
1/8 teaspoon ground nutmeg
1/8 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1/2 red onion, finely diced
1/2 cup raisins or 1/2 cup dried currant
3 tablespoons capers, drained

Steps:

  • Rinse lentils well, drain. Place in a pot and cover with a 3-4 inches of water, bring to a boil, reduce to simmer. Check lentils for doneness after 10 minutes, but they should take about 15 minutes in total. You will know they are cooked if they still retain a slight tooth - al dente! (Overcooking the lentils is the death of this dish) Drain & rinse the lentils under cold water and set aside.
  • In a small bowl, make the dressing by whisking together the olive, vinegar, maple syrup, mustard and all the spices (salt through cinnamon).
  • In a large serving bowl, gently combine the lentils and dressing. Add the onions, cranberries and capers and stir to combine well. If using other add-ins such as herbs, greens, or cheese, wait to add until just before serving. Otherwise, this salad can hang out in the fridge for as long as a couple days!

BOOZY FRUIT SALAD



Boozy Fruit Salad image

A great fruit salad with a bit of a boozy twist. Great for summer cookouts! Best served the same day as preparation.

4 cups seedless watermelon balls
3 cups fresh strawberries
3 cups sliced bananas
2 ½ cups mandarin orange slices
1 cup orange-flavored vodka

Steps:

  • Combine watermelon, strawberries, bananas, and mandarin slices in a large bowl. Pour in vodka and toss to coat. Cover with plastic wrap and let chill in the refrigerator until serving.

THE BEST SALAD WE EVER ATE!



The Best Salad We Ever Ate! image

Sweet, sour, tangy, creamy and crunchy--this is the ultimate salad. So many tastes and textured, we just love it. You can substitute strawberries for the apples. YUM! Also good with grilled chicken or grilled shrimp! Cooking time reflects the preparation of the pecans. It makes a lot, though...so once you have them made, you have enough for several salads.

1/2 cup sugar
1 teaspoon dry mustard
1 teaspoon salt
2/3 cup white vinegar
3 tablespoons apple cider vinegar
4 1/2 teaspoons onion juice
2 teaspoons Worcestershire sauce
1 cup vegetable oil
4 cups greens
2 green onions, chopped
1 cup blue cheese, crumbled
1 granny smith apple, chopped
2 large egg whites
1/2 teaspoon salt
3/4 teaspoon sugar
2 teaspoons Worcestershire sauce
2 teaspoons paprika
1 1/2 teaspoons cayenne pepper
4 1/2 cups pecans (about 1 lb)
6 tablespoons butter

Steps:

  • For the Dressing: Put everything in container and shake.
  • For the Pecans:.
  • Preheat oven to 325°F, beat the egg whites with salt until foamy.
  • Add sugar Worcestershire, paprika, and cayenne.
  • Fold in pecans and melted butter.
  • Spread pecans over baking sheet.
  • Bake 30-40 minutes, stirring every 10 minutes.
  • Remove from oven and cool.
  • Store pecans in an airtight container.
  • Mix field greens, green onions, blue cheese, apple and pecans.
  • Toss with dressing--to your taste.
  • You will have leftover dressing and pecans.

BEST EVER BOOZY FRUIT SALAD RECIPE - (4.5/5)

1 small cantaloupe melon, peeled and diced small
1 lb. strawberries, sliced
1 pint blueberries
2 cups diced fresh pineapple
3 kiwi, peeled, halved, and thinly sliced
1/4 c. Limoncello liqueur
4 Tbsp. minced fresh mint or basil

Steps:

  • Combine the fruit in a large bowl. Pour in the Limoncello and toss with a wooden spoon to coat the fruit pieces. Let sit at least fifteen minutes to soak up the booze. Fold in the fresh herbs just before serving.
